By Kandace Williams
Staff Writer
kwilli@my.westrii £iht
Remember the
guy who used to make
headlines by playing
basketball and dressing
in drag? He was a
little rowdy and very
flamboyant. He was
once married to Carmen
Electra.
Well, that guy is
Dennis Rodman— and
he now wants to get
involved with Atlanta
basketball.
Rodman wants to
coach Atlanta's new
Womens National
Basketball Association
team. But there is one
problem, the ow ner of the

team, Ron Terwilliger,
wants a woman to coach,
and wearing make-up
and putting on heels
doesn’t count.
Rodman would be
able to generate buzz
for the unnamed team,
which is set to begin
playing in 2008, but
Terwilliger feels that he
(Rodman) lacks essential
skills that he is looking
for in a coach.
“My own view is
that I don’t think he’s
currently qualified to
be a head coach. And
we’d prefer to have a
women’s coach since
it’s a women’s league,”
Terwilliger said.
Terwilliger said he
has interviewed three
candidates and hopes
to have a coach named
by Thanksgiving. The
real-estate executive
has spoken with former
Georgia All-American
Teresa Edwards. Edwards
is now in her second
season as an assistant
coach with the WNBA’s
Minnesota Lynx.
“We’re hoping one
way or another she’ll end
up with the franchise,”
Terwilliger said. “We
need someone who
knows the league, knows
how it works, knows the
players and knows the
college talent coming
up.”
As of now, no one
has been hired for the
position.
